Summary - Entrance Hall, Living Room, Sitting Room, Kitchen, Two Bedrooms, Bathroom, Parking space to the rear.
Description - The property is built from brick under a slate roof, forming an end terrace, likely dating back to the late 19th century. It has remained under the same ownership for several years and has recently been rented out. General modernisation has been carried out, although additional enhancements would be advantageous. The ground floor includes a well-proportioned reception room, along with a single-storey kitchen and bathroom extension. On the first floor, there are two spacious bedrooms, with the potential to move the bathroom to this level.
Location & Amenities - Willaston has always proved to be a popular place to live as it offers a wide selection of local amenities including primary school, nursery, local shops, a selection of public houses, a village hall with an active social calendar and community groups, plus a church and a mini supermarket. There are highly reputable local schools and nursery's easily accessible from the property.
The historic market town of Nantwich is a short travelling distance away, approximately 2 miles, and is renowned for its beautiful architecture and character. The town offers an excellent selection of individual independent shops, eateries , restaurants and bars but also provides more extensive facilities including renowned primary and secondary schools and three major supermarkets. The property is considered ideally placed for the commuter, with a network of excellent road links giving immediate access to the M6 motorway at junction 16 via the A500 (7 miles), Crewe station (2.5 miles) offers fast access into London and other major cities with future improvements underway.
